Toggle navigation
Patchwork
linux-kernel
Patches
Bundles
About this project
Login
Register
Mail settings
Show patches with
: Submitter =
Ian Rogers
| State =
Action Required
| Archived =
No
| 1899 patches
Series
Submitter
State
any
Action Required
New
Under Review
Accepted
Rejected
RFC
Not Applicable
Changes Requested
Awaiting Upstream
Superseded
Deferred
Unresolved
Repeat Merge
Corrupt patch
Search
Archived
No
Yes
Both
Delegate
------
Nobody
snail
snail
patchwork-bot
patchwork-bot
patchwork-bot
ww
ww
ww
Apply
«
1
2
…
5
6
7
…
18
19
»
Patch
Series
A/R/T
S/W/F
Date
Submitter
Delegate
State
[v4,03/53] libperf: Lazily allocate mmap event copy
Improvements to memory use
1 - -
-
-
-
2023-11-02
Ian Rogers
New
[v4,02/53] perf record: Lazy load kernel symbols
Improvements to memory use
1 1 -
-
-
-
2023-11-02
Ian Rogers
New
[v4,01/53] perf comm: Use regular mutex
Improvements to memory use
1 - -
-
-
-
2023-11-02
Ian Rogers
New
[v1,9/9] perf vendor events intel: Update tsx_cycles_per_elision metrics
[v1,1/9] perf vendor events intel: Update alderlake/alderlake events to v1.23
- - -
-
-
-
2023-10-26
Ian Rogers
New
[v1,8/9] perf vendor events intel: Update bonnell version number to v5
[v1,1/9] perf vendor events intel: Update alderlake/alderlake events to v1.23
- - -
-
-
-
2023-10-26
Ian Rogers
New
[v1,7/9] perf vendor events intel: Update westmereex events to v4
[v1,1/9] perf vendor events intel: Update alderlake/alderlake events to v1.23
- - -
-
-
-
2023-10-26
Ian Rogers
New
[v1,6/9] perf vendor events intel: Update meteorlake events to v1.06
[v1,1/9] perf vendor events intel: Update alderlake/alderlake events to v1.23
- - -
-
-
-
2023-10-26
Ian Rogers
New
[v1,5/9] perf vendor events intel: Update knightslanding events to v16
[v1,1/9] perf vendor events intel: Update alderlake/alderlake events to v1.23
- - -
-
-
-
2023-10-26
Ian Rogers
New
[v1,4/9] perf vendor events intel: Add typo fix for ivybridge FP
[v1,1/9] perf vendor events intel: Update alderlake/alderlake events to v1.23
- - -
-
-
-
2023-10-26
Ian Rogers
New
[v1,3/9] perf vendor events intel: Update a spelling in haswell/haswellx
[v1,1/9] perf vendor events intel: Update alderlake/alderlake events to v1.23
- - -
-
-
-
2023-10-26
Ian Rogers
New
[v1,2/9] perf vendor events intel: Update emeraldrapids to v1.01
[v1,1/9] perf vendor events intel: Update alderlake/alderlake events to v1.23
- - -
-
-
-
2023-10-26
Ian Rogers
New
[v1,1/9] perf vendor events intel: Update alderlake/alderlake events to v1.23
[v1,1/9] perf vendor events intel: Update alderlake/alderlake events to v1.23
- 1 -
-
-
-
2023-10-26
Ian Rogers
New
[v3,50/50] perf threads: Reduce table size from 256 to 8
Improvements to memory use
- - -
-
-
-
2023-10-24
Ian Rogers
New
[v3,49/50] perf threads: Switch from rbtree to hashmap
Improvements to memory use
- - -
-
-
-
2023-10-24
Ian Rogers
New
[v3,48/50] perf threads: Move threads to its own files
Improvements to memory use
- - -
-
-
-
2023-10-24
Ian Rogers
New
[v3,47/50] perf machine: Move fprintf to for_each loop and a callback
Improvements to memory use
- - -
-
-
-
2023-10-24
Ian Rogers
New
[v3,46/50] perf trace: Ignore thread hashing in summary
Improvements to memory use
- - -
-
-
-
2023-10-24
Ian Rogers
New
[v3,45/50] perf report: Sort child tasks by tid
Improvements to memory use
- - -
-
-
-
2023-10-24
Ian Rogers
New
[v3,44/50] perf dso: Reorder variables to save space in struct dso
Improvements to memory use
- - -
-
-
-
2023-10-24
Ian Rogers
New
[v3,43/50] perf maps: Locking tidy up of nr_maps
Improvements to memory use
- - -
-
-
-
2023-10-24
Ian Rogers
New
[v3,42/50] perf maps: Hide maps internals
Improvements to memory use
- - -
-
-
-
2023-10-24
Ian Rogers
New
[v3,41/50] perf maps: Get map before returning in maps__find_next_entry
Improvements to memory use
- - -
-
-
-
2023-10-24
Ian Rogers
New
[v3,40/50] perf maps: Get map before returning in maps__find_by_name
Improvements to memory use
- - -
-
-
-
2023-10-24
Ian Rogers
New
[v3,39/50] perf maps: Get map before returning in maps__find
Improvements to memory use
- - -
-
-
-
2023-10-24
Ian Rogers
New
[v3,38/50] perf maps: Switch from rbtree to lazily sorted array for addresses
Improvements to memory use
- - -
-
-
-
2023-10-24
Ian Rogers
New
[v3,37/50] perf maps: Fix up overlaps during fixup_end
Improvements to memory use
- - -
-
-
-
2023-10-24
Ian Rogers
New
[v3,36/50] perf maps: Reduce scope of map_rb_node and maps internals
Improvements to memory use
- - -
-
-
-
2023-10-24
Ian Rogers
New
[v3,35/50] perf maps: Add find next entry to give entry after the given map
Improvements to memory use
- - -
-
-
-
2023-10-24
Ian Rogers
New
[v3,34/50] perf maps: Add maps__load_first
Improvements to memory use
- - -
-
-
-
2023-10-24
Ian Rogers
New
[v3,33/50] perf maps: Rename clone to copy from
Improvements to memory use
- - -
-
-
-
2023-10-24
Ian Rogers
New
[v3,32/50] perf maps: Do simple merge if given map doesn't overlap
Improvements to memory use
- - -
-
-
-
2023-10-24
Ian Rogers
New
[v3,31/50] perf maps: Refactor maps__fixup_overlappings
Improvements to memory use
- - -
-
-
-
2023-10-24
Ian Rogers
New
[v3,30/50] perf debug: Expose debug file
Improvements to memory use
- - -
-
-
-
2023-10-24
Ian Rogers
New
[v3,29/50] perf maps: Add remove maps function to remove a map based on callback
Improvements to memory use
- - -
-
-
-
2023-10-24
Ian Rogers
New
[v3,28/50] perf maps: Add maps__for_each_map to call a function on each entry
Improvements to memory use
- - -
-
-
-
2023-10-24
Ian Rogers
New
[v3,27/50] perf thread: Add missing RC_CHK_ACCESS
Improvements to memory use
- - -
-
-
-
2023-10-24
Ian Rogers
New
[v3,26/50] perf maps: Move symbol maps functions to maps.c
Improvements to memory use
- - -
-
-
-
2023-10-24
Ian Rogers
New
[v3,25/50] perf map: Simplify map_ip/unmap_ip and make map size smaller
Improvements to memory use
- - -
-
-
-
2023-10-24
Ian Rogers
New
[v3,24/50] perf events: Remove scandir in thread synthesis
Improvements to memory use
- - -
-
-
-
2023-10-24
Ian Rogers
New
[v3,23/50] perf header: Switch mem topology to io_dir__readdir
Improvements to memory use
- - -
-
-
-
2023-10-24
Ian Rogers
New
[v3,22/50] perf bpf: Don't synthesize BPF events when disabled
Improvements to memory use
- - -
-
-
-
2023-10-24
Ian Rogers
New
[v3,21/50] perf pmu: Switch to io_dir__readdir
Improvements to memory use
- - -
-
-
-
2023-10-24
Ian Rogers
New
[v3,20/50] perf record: Be lazier in allocating lost samples buffer
Improvements to memory use
- - -
-
-
-
2023-10-24
Ian Rogers
New
[v3,19/50] perf maps: Switch modules tree walk to io_dir__readdir
Improvements to memory use
- - -
-
-
-
2023-10-24
Ian Rogers
New
[v3,18/50] tools lib api: Add io_dir an allocation free readdir alternative
Improvements to memory use
- - -
-
-
-
2023-10-24
Ian Rogers
New
[v3,17/50] tools api fs: Avoid reading whole file for a 1 byte bool
Improvements to memory use
- - -
-
-
-
2023-10-24
Ian Rogers
New
[v3,16/50] tools api fs: Switch filename__read_str to use io.h
Improvements to memory use
- - -
-
-
-
2023-10-24
Ian Rogers
New
[v3,15/50] perf machine thread: Remove exited threads by default
Improvements to memory use
- - -
-
-
-
2023-10-24
Ian Rogers
New
[v3,14/50] perf mmap: Lazily initialize zstd streams
Improvements to memory use
- - -
-
-
-
2023-10-24
Ian Rogers
New
[v3,13/50] libperf: Lazily allocate mmap event copy
Improvements to memory use
- - -
-
-
-
2023-10-24
Ian Rogers
New
[v3,12/50] perf record: Lazy load kernel symbols
Improvements to memory use
- - -
-
-
-
2023-10-24
Ian Rogers
New
[v3,11/50] perf mem_info: Add and use map_symbol__exit and addr_map_symbol__exit
Improvements to memory use
- - -
-
-
-
2023-10-24
Ian Rogers
New
[v3,10/50] perf callchain: Minor layout changes to callchain_list
Improvements to memory use
- - -
-
-
-
2023-10-24
Ian Rogers
New
[v3,09/50] perf callchain: Make brtype_stat in callchain_list optional
Improvements to memory use
- - -
-
-
-
2023-10-24
Ian Rogers
New
[v3,08/50] perf callchain: Make display use of branch_type_stat const
Improvements to memory use
- - -
-
-
-
2023-10-24
Ian Rogers
New
[v3,07/50] perf offcpu: Add missed btf_free
Improvements to memory use
- - -
-
-
-
2023-10-24
Ian Rogers
New
[v3,06/50] perf threads: Remove unused dead thread list
Improvements to memory use
- - -
-
-
-
2023-10-24
Ian Rogers
New
[v3,05/50] perf hist: Add missing puts to hist__account_cycles
Improvements to memory use
- - -
-
-
-
2023-10-24
Ian Rogers
New
[v3,04/50] libperf rc_check: Add RC_CHK_EQUAL
Improvements to memory use
- - -
-
-
-
2023-10-24
Ian Rogers
New
[v3,03/50] libperf rc_check: Make implicit enabling work for GCC
Improvements to memory use
- - -
-
-
-
2023-10-24
Ian Rogers
New
[v3,02/50] perf machine: Avoid out of bounds LBR memory read
Improvements to memory use
- - -
-
-
-
2023-10-24
Ian Rogers
New
[v3,01/50] perf rwsem: Add debug mode that uses a mutex
Improvements to memory use
- - -
-
-
-
2023-10-24
Ian Rogers
New
[v2,7/7] perf pmu: Lazily compute default config
PMU performance improvements
- 1 -
-
-
-
2023-10-12
Ian Rogers
New
[v2,6/7] perf pmu-events: Remember the perf_events_map for a PMU
PMU performance improvements
- - 1
-
-
-
2023-10-12
Ian Rogers
New
[v2,5/7] perf pmu: Const-ify perf_pmu__config_terms
PMU performance improvements
- 1 -
-
-
-
2023-10-12
Ian Rogers
New
[v2,4/7] perf pmu: Const-ify file APIs
PMU performance improvements
- 1 -
-
-
-
2023-10-12
Ian Rogers
New
[v2,3/7] perf arm-spe: Move PMU initialization from default config code
PMU performance improvements
- 1 1
-
-
-
2023-10-12
Ian Rogers
New
[v2,2/7] perf intel-pt: Move PMU initialization from default config code
PMU performance improvements
- 1 -
-
-
-
2023-10-12
Ian Rogers
New
[v2,1/7] perf pmu: Rename perf_pmu__get_default_config to perf_pmu__arch_init
PMU performance improvements
- - -
-
-
-
2023-10-12
Ian Rogers
New
[v2,13/13] perf machine thread: Remove exited threads by default
Improvements to memory use
- - -
-
-
-
2023-10-12
Ian Rogers
New
[v2,12/13] perf mmap: Lazily initialize zstd streams
Improvements to memory use
- - -
-
-
-
2023-10-12
Ian Rogers
New
[v2,11/13] libperf: Lazily allocate mmap event copy
Improvements to memory use
- - -
-
-
-
2023-10-12
Ian Rogers
New
[v2,10/13] perf record: Lazy load kernel symbols
Improvements to memory use
- - -
-
-
-
2023-10-12
Ian Rogers
New
[v2,09/13] perf mem_info: Add and use map_symbol__exit and addr_map_symbol__exit
Improvements to memory use
- - -
-
-
-
2023-10-12
Ian Rogers
New
[v2,08/13] perf callchain: Minor layout changes to callchain_list
Improvements to memory use
- - -
-
-
-
2023-10-12
Ian Rogers
New
[v2,07/13] perf callchain: Make brtype_stat in callchain_list optional
Improvements to memory use
- - -
-
-
-
2023-10-12
Ian Rogers
New
[v2,06/13] perf callchain: Make display use of branch_type_stat const
Improvements to memory use
- - -
-
-
-
2023-10-12
Ian Rogers
New
[v2,05/13] perf offcpu: Add missed btf_free
Improvements to memory use
- - -
-
-
-
2023-10-12
Ian Rogers
New
[v2,04/13] perf threads: Remove unused dead thread list
Improvements to memory use
- - -
-
-
-
2023-10-12
Ian Rogers
New
[v2,03/13] perf hist: Add missing puts to hist__account_cycles
Improvements to memory use
- - -
-
-
-
2023-10-12
Ian Rogers
New
[v2,02/13] libperf rc_check: Make implicit enabling work for GCC
Improvements to memory use
- - -
-
-
-
2023-10-12
Ian Rogers
New
[v2,01/13] perf machine: Avoid out of bounds LBR memory read
Improvements to memory use
- - -
-
-
-
2023-10-12
Ian Rogers
New
[v1,3/3] perf hist: Add missing puts to hist__account_cycles
[v1,1/3] perf machine: Avoid out of bounds LBR memory read
- - -
-
-
-
2023-10-09
Ian Rogers
New
[v1,2/3] libperf rc_check: Make implicit enabling work for GCC
[v1,1/3] perf machine: Avoid out of bounds LBR memory read
- - -
-
-
-
2023-10-09
Ian Rogers
New
[v1,1/3] perf machine: Avoid out of bounds LBR memory read
[v1,1/3] perf machine: Avoid out of bounds LBR memory read
- - -
-
-
-
2023-10-09
Ian Rogers
New
[v3,18/18] perf bpf_counter: Fix a few memory leaks
clang-tools support in tools
- - -
-
-
-
2023-10-09
Ian Rogers
New
[v3,17/18] perf header: Fix various error path memory leaks
clang-tools support in tools
- - -
-
-
-
2023-10-09
Ian Rogers
New
[v3,16/18] perf trace-event-info: Avoid passing NULL value to closedir
clang-tools support in tools
- - -
-
-
-
2023-10-09
Ian Rogers
New
[v3,15/18] tools api: Avoid potential double free
clang-tools support in tools
- - -
-
-
-
2023-10-09
Ian Rogers
New
[v3,14/18] perf parse-events: Fix unlikely memory leak when cloning terms
clang-tools support in tools
- - -
-
-
-
2023-10-09
Ian Rogers
New
[v3,13/18] perf lock: Fix a memory leak on an error path
clang-tools support in tools
- - -
-
-
-
2023-10-09
Ian Rogers
New
[v3,12/18] perf svghelper: Avoid memory leak
clang-tools support in tools
- - -
-
-
-
2023-10-09
Ian Rogers
New
[v3,11/18] perf hists browser: Avoid potential NULL dereference
clang-tools support in tools
- - -
-
-
-
2023-10-09
Ian Rogers
New
[v3,10/18] perf hists browser: Reorder variables to reduce padding
clang-tools support in tools
- - -
-
-
-
2023-10-09
Ian Rogers
New
[v3,09/18] perf dlfilter: Be defensive against potential NULL dereference
clang-tools support in tools
- - -
-
-
-
2023-10-09
Ian Rogers
New
[v3,08/18] perf mem-events: Avoid uninitialized read
clang-tools support in tools
- - -
-
-
-
2023-10-09
Ian Rogers
New
[v3,07/18] perf jitdump: Avoid memory leak
clang-tools support in tools
- - -
-
-
-
2023-10-09
Ian Rogers
New
[v3,06/18] perf env: Remove unnecessary NULL tests
clang-tools support in tools
- - -
-
-
-
2023-10-09
Ian Rogers
New
[v3,05/18] perf buildid-cache: Fix use of uninitialized value
clang-tools support in tools
- - -
-
-
-
2023-10-09
Ian Rogers
New
[v3,04/18] perf bench uprobe: Fix potential use of memory after free
clang-tools support in tools
- - -
-
-
-
2023-10-09
Ian Rogers
New
«
1
2
…
5
6
7
…
18
19
»